Recently, Fu Ruoqing, chairman of China Film Group Corporation, revealed at an event that the movie "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" directed by Tsui Hark is currently in production and will be released this year. Fu Ruoqing introduced that "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" will combine the familiar martial arts stories with the spirit of the times and contemporary aesthetics, and will present the chivalrous spirit and family and country ideals that are deeply rooted in the hearts of the Chinese people on the big screen. Fu Ruoqing also responded to why he chose Xiao Zhan to play the role of Guo Jing. He said: "Xiao Zhan meets all the characteristics of the film. We also conducted repeated evaluations, including makeup photos and various trainings, and finally decided that Xiao Zhan would play the role in this film." The film "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" is adapted from Jin Yong's original novel. Xiao Zhan will play Guo Jing and Zhuang Dafei will play Huang Rong. The film tells the story of the Mongolian army led by Genghis Khan to the west to destroy the Jin Dynasty and to the south to destroy the Song Dynasty. The masters of various martial arts schools in the Central Plains fought in the chaos. The great knights represented by Guo Jing gathered the strength of the Central Plains martial arts for the country and the people and defended Xiangyang. |
